Ichthyologist Eugenie Clark, π˜›π˜©π˜¦ 𝘚𝘩𝘒𝘳𝘬 π˜“π˜’π˜₯𝘺, died #OTD in 2015. A pioneer in scuba diving for research purposes, she proved sharks are capable of learning and was a world authority on Tetraodontiformes. She founded Mote Marine Lab and used her fame to drive global marine conservation. #WomenInSTEM
